Widows Premiere Interviews | London Film Festival 2018

 

Widows had its European Premiere at the 2018 London Film Festival. The female led crime drama is co-written and directed by Twelve Years a Slave Oscar Winning director Steve McQueen. Gone Girl and Sharp Objects writer Gillian Flynn co-wrote the script from the Lynda LaPlante original. At tonight's premiere we spoke to Voila Davis, LFF director Tricia Tuttle, producer Iain Canning, and head of Film4 Daniel Battsek.

 

The film stars Viola Davis, Liam Neeson, Michelle Rodriguez, Elizabeth Debicki, Carrie Coon, Colin Farrell, Robert Duvall, Jon Bernthal and Daniel Kaluuya.

Johnny English Premiere - Rowan Atkinson, Olly Murs, Olga Kurylenko

 

Mr Bean and Blackadder actor Rowan Atkinson has given us some of the funniest moments of TV and film over the years, and he has returned as super spy/Barclaycard ambassador Johnny English for Johnny English Strikes Again. The red carpet was unfurled at the Curzon Mayfair this evening for a special screening and Atkinson, Ben Miller, Bond Girl Olga Kurylenko and director David Kerr were in attendance.

 

The film also stars also stars Emma Thompson, Jake Lacy, Charles Dance, Miranda Hennessy, Adam James and Pippa Bennett-Warner.

Lady Gaga & Bradley Cooper wow at the A Star is Born London Premiere

 

Lady Gaga (Stefani Joanne Angelina Germanotta) wowed the crowds at the UK premiere of A Star is Born in Leicester Square, London.
It marks the directorial debut of Bradley Cooper and he stars in the film with Lady Gaga in the leading role. Best known as the singer of Bad Romance, Paparazzi and Telephone there is Oscar buzz surrounding her performance.
